How NOT to Run Out of Air When You Speak

A common issue I hear from clients on the topic of speaking is that they often feel like they are running out of air when they speak

For some people, this happens only in higher-pressure situations, like if they're giving a talk in front of a group of people.  Other folks report that it's ingrained in their speaking habits and happens all the time.

First thing to recognize is that you have to breathe (let air in) before you speak.  Speaking is on an out-breath, so there's an in-breath just before. 

HOW you take in air before you speak will affect whether or not you're running out of air...and a lot of the HOW is tied in with your posture at that moment.

The resaon WHY peoples' breathing gets out of whack when they're speaking can vary.  Here are a few common reasons:

  • Rushing to speak (so that you're not interrupted or thinking that if you go on too long, people will loose interest)

  • Forgetting to pause.  Speaking many sentences on one breath and running out of air.

  • Trying to hard to stand up straight when you speak and over-correcting your posture, which creates tension and less room in your body for you to breathe.

  • Nervousness or Excitement - Either of these emotions can potentially be ungrounding.  If you're not anchored in your body when you're speaking, your posture won't be balance and you might feel like you're just breathing way up in your chest.
